Summary and
additional information:
<- L. J. Stal, Royal Netherlands Institute for Sea Research (NIOZ), the Netherlands; CCY0436. Water column; country of origin unknown, Baltic Sea, Finnish Exclusive Economic Zone; sampling date: 2004. Assignment to the species Synechococcus sp. is preliminary. Phototrophic. It cannot be excluded that the strain produces cyanobacterial toxins that can be dangerous to humans and pets. Non-axenic. Strain-specific literature (27359). (Medium 1677, 18°C, shaken at 120 rpm, 16 hours at 160 lux illumination, 8-hours dark period. Transfer interval of 4 weeks).
